Техническое обслуживание

Вы просматриваете версию 5.5. Для самой новой информации, перейдите на страницу Техническое обслуживание для версии 8.0

Мониторинг состояния

Enterprise Server включает браузерный Health Monitor. Доступный администратору через страницу Health в браузерном интерфейсе Workspace Enterprise Server, он предоставляет наглядную сводку состояния хост-машины и системы хранения Enterprise Server.

Помимо быстрого визуального обзора состояния Enterprise Server, страница также позволяет скачать все файлы журналов одним Zip-архивом, а также упрощает создание отчёта о состоянии — также удобно упакованного в Zip-файл — который можно передать в службу поддержки Altium, а затем разработчикам.

Установка Enterprise Server также включает автономный инструмент Health Monitor, который можно запустить на компьютере, где размещён Enterprise Server, с помощью ярлыка на рабочем столе, создаваемого при установке Enterprise Server. В качестве альтернативы инструмент Health Monitor можно найти в папке \Program Files (x86)\Altium\Altium365\Tools\HealthMonitor как исполняемый файл avhealth.exe. Обратите внимание, что в этой папке также есть упрощённый инструмент командной строки: avConsoleHealth.exe. В автономном варианте Health Monitor работает как независимый компонент, который опрашивает Enterprise Server и его хост-систему, и поэтому способен предоставлять критически важные данные и информацию даже в маловероятном случае, если Enterprise Server работает не полностью корректно. Он предоставляет дополнительные возможности по сравнению с браузерным Health Monitor.

Автономный Health Monitor ориентирован на ИТ-подразделения и в общих чертах охватывает следующие критически важные области:

  • Enterprise Server Environment – состояние аппаратного обеспечения хост-ПК, например жёстких дисков, памяти, CPU и достаточность производительности.
  • Enterprise Server Backend – состояние поддерживающих сервер базы данных, файлового хранилища и репозитория.
  • Enterprise Server Services – состояние набора серверных служб, размещённых как пулы приложений IIS, таких как службы Identity, Authorization и License Manager.

Резервное копирование и восстановление

Со временем ваш Workspace будет содержать всё больший и впечатляющий объём данных. Ценность этих данных трудно переоценить, поскольку это смесь исходных данных, которые можно повторно использовать в будущих проектах, а также данных, на основе которых изготавливаются и собираются прошлые, текущие и будущие изделия. Это данные, выпущенные и утверждённые под самым строгим контролем и надёжно сохранённые с максимальной целостностью. И, как и для любых ценных данных, долговечность их целостности обеспечивается возможностью выполнять резервное копирование.

Установка Enterprise Server предусматривает архивирование данных Workspace за счёт предоставления инструмента Backup & Restore, управляемого из командной строки. Исполняемый файл инструмента — avbackup.exe — расположен в папке \Program Files (x86)\Altium\Altium365\Tools\BackupTool при установке Enterprise Server по умолчанию.

Восстановление резервной копии возможно только в ту же версию Enterprise Server, из которой эта копия была сделана. В связи с этим может быть хорошей идеей хранить установщик этого сервера и соответствующие файлы лицензии вместе с Zip-архивом резервной копии.
Резервное копирование и восстановление с использованием этого инструмента в настоящее время поддерживается только для установки Enterprise Server, использующей базу данных Firebird в качестве backend. Пример резервного копирования и восстановления Enterprise Server, использующего базу данных Oracle в качестве backend, см. в Backup Process with an Oracle Backend и Restore Process with an Oracle Backend соответственно.

Поддержка прокси-сервера

Для компании, которая выходит в интернет через прокси-сервер, сведения о конфигурации прокси можно задать для Enterprise Server после установки. Это позволяет службам Enterprise Server успешно подключаться к интернет-сервисам через корпоративный прокси-сервер по мере необходимости.

Сведения о конфигурации прокси вводятся в разделе [Proxy] файла LocalVault.ini. При установке Enterprise Server по умолчанию этот файл находится по следующему пути: \Program Files (x86)\Altium\Altium365.

  • Информация о прокси-сервере задаётся в INI-файле after после установки Enterprise Server. IIS (пулы приложений, связанные с Enterprise Server) не следует останавливать перед редактированием файла, но must следует перезапустить после внесения изменений и сохранения INI-файла, чтобы изменения вступили в силу.
  • Хотя доступ в интернет по защищённому протоколу (HTTPS) поддерживается самим прокси-сервером, использование прокси-сервера со схемой HTTPS через установку Enterprise Server не поддерживается. Например, если вы хотите получить некоторые компоненты через панель Manufacturer Part Search panel в Altium Designer — подключённую по HTTPS — всё будет работать нормально. Но если вы хотите указать прокси-сервер через Enterprise Server в формате https://myproxy:3128, такой прокси работать не будет.

Инструмент управления сервером из командной строки

Enterprise Server предоставляет инструмент командной строки для следующих аспектов конфигурации Enterprise Server:

  • User Management – позволяет предварительно загрузить в Enterprise Server массовые конфигурации пользователей и ролей, полученные из корпоративных систем или записей, тем самым избегая необходимости создавать записи по одной через браузерный интерфейс Workspace Enterprise Server. Инструмент поддерживает импорт данных Users, Roles и членства пользователей в ролях из стандартных CSV-файлов *.csv с разделителями-запятыми.
  • Part Choice Indexing – позволяет вручную выполнить переиндексацию Part Choices для компонентов библиотек Workspace, получаемых через определённые пользователем Part Sources (подключения к локальным базам данных компонентов).

Инструмент — avconfiguration.exe — входит в установку Enterprise Server и находится в папке \Program Files (x86)\Altium\Altium365\Tools\VaultConfigurationTool.

Хотя инструмент можно использовать для автоматизированного управления пользователями, рекомендуемый подход — использовать функциональность LDAP synchronization functionality.
Переиндексацию Part choice можно настроить на автоматическое выполнение. Настройте это с помощью поля Indexing part choices every при определении пользовательского источника компонентов из базы данных. Источники компонентов определяются администратором Workspace на странице Part Providers (Admin – Part Providers) в браузерном интерфейсе Workspace. Дополнительные сведения см. в Configuring a Custom Database Part Source.
Читайте о Command Line Management Tool.

Инструмент импорта базы данных компонентов из CSV

Установка Enterprise Server включает инструмент импорта базы данных компонентов из CSV, который можно использовать для загрузки данных компонентов в Enterprise Server из файла, экспортированного из корпоративной системы, например ERP или PLM. Реализованный как настраиваемый пакетный (*.bat) файл, настольный инструмент импортирует данные компонентов из целевого файла электронной таблицы (*.csv) в Workspace в соответствии с существующими шаблонами Workspace или выделенным конфигурационным файлом.

Инструмент командной строки можно найти в папке \Program Files (x86)\Altium\Altium365\Tools\CSVImport установки Enterprise Server. См. csv-import.bat для информации о синтаксисе командной строки, используемом с инструментом, либо просто запустите пакетный файл без атрибутов для получения более подробной информации.

Notes:

  • Инструмент и поддерживающая его папка Java runtime (JRE8) могут быть скопированы и запущены в любом месте, включая другой сетевой компьютер, отличный от хост-машины Enterprise Server.
  • В зависимости от расположения инструмента может потребоваться запуск с повышенными правами (Administrator).
  • Синтаксис инструмента чувствителен к регистру, как и ссылки в шаблонах Workspace и любых используемых конфигурационных файлах.

Source file format:

Инструмент импорта CSV-данных требует, чтобы исходный CSV-файл с разделителями-запятыми использовал кодировку UTF-8. Если файл использует другие форматы кодировки, такие как ANSI или UTF-8-BOM, импортёр не будет корректно разбирать расширенные символы (например, µ) или может не принять исходный файл *.csv.

Если вы создаёте простой CSV-файл для тестирования, учтите, что некоторые версии Windows Notepad не сохраняют в совместимом формате UTF-8. Если есть сомнения, можно использовать альтернативный текстовый редактор, например Notepad++, чтобы создавать и сохранять файлы в кодировке UTF-8; он также полезен для проверки формата кодировки файлов *.csv, экспортированных из исходной корпоративной системы.

AI-LocalizedЛокализовано с помощью ИИ
Если вы обнаружили проблему, выделите текст/изображение и нажмитеCtrl + Enter, чтобы отправить нам свой отзыв.